@OldBagLady
Don't worry. It's not in the least bit cliquey at all here. It sounds like you're already baiting safe, and know a thing or two about how to wind them up, so welcome aboard.

Myspace certainly does have a lot of scammers, but as social networking sites go they're no worse than most; just a lot bigger generally. They do a reasonable job of keeping the lid on reported scammers too; their pages usually get killed very soon after I report them at least. Unfortunately, so many go unreported and keep signing back up again, that there's always going to be a constant stream of them. Given that most scammer accounts only seem to be active for a few days, I suspect that some very industrious lads are creating new ones there all the time, although others seem to use the same ones for as long as they can before they get deleted.

As for how to deal with multiple baits, I create an e-mail folder for each of them and stick all the correspondence in there for easy reference. I also use the message history facility on instant messenger and take some time to skim over previous conversations before chatting. When I was just starting out, I kept a detailed crib sheet on each ongoing bait, but that's fallen by the wayside somewhat. The lads generally don't care that much for your story, so once you've acted out your persona a few times, it'll be good enough to convince them.

Don't hold your breath on a lad doing anything honest. Everything they tell you is a lie designed to make you part with your money. Even their "honest" replies are just more lies to make you part with your money. Do you see a pattern there? As for educating a lad in any way, shape or form - that's a HUGE no no. What you teach him, he can use to better scam someone else. No matter what they tell you, that's their purpose in life.

As for the beads, expect the lad to promise you the Earth, then bitch and moan about how he can't afford to send them without "a little help" from you up front.
